摘 要:以硬脂酸钙为参照,研究了氢氧化镧用作PVC热稳定剂的热稳定特性及透明和电绝缘性能。结果表明,氢氧化镧具有类似于硬脂酸钙的热稳定特性,是一种长期型热稳定剂;在合理并用硬脂酸锌和β-二酮等有机辅助热稳定剂的情况下,具有略优于硬脂酸钙的热稳定效能,所稳定PVC的透明性不如硬脂酸钙,但电绝缘性较好。The heat stabilizing characteristics and transparency and electrical insulation performance of lanthanum hydroxide as a heat stabilizer for PVC were studied by taking calcium stearate as the reference.It was shown that the heat stabilizing characteristics of lanthanum hydroxide was similar to that of calcium stearate,that is,it was a long-term type heat stabilizer.The composition of lanthanum hydroxide combined rationally with zinc stearate and organic costabilizers such as β-diketones showed heat stabilizing efficiency somewhat better than that of calcium stearate.PVC stabilized with the composite stabilizers based on lanthanum hydroxide had lower transparency but higher electrical insulation compared with those based on calcium stearate.
